Summary

HondaeBay logo (American HondaeBay logo Motor Co.) is recalling all HondaeBay logo Genuine Accessory Tonneau Covers, part number 08Z07-T6Z-100F, sold for installation on 2017-2020 Ridgeline trucks. If the tonneau cover is not properly secured in the open or closed position, wind resistance may cause the cover to flip and buckle. If this occurs, the hinges between the center and rear panel may deform, possibly allowing the rear panel to separate from the vehicle.

 

Remedy

HondaeBay logo will notify all registered owners of 2017-2020 HondaeBay logo Ridgelines, and dealers will install tethers onto any HondaeBay logo Genuine Accessory Tonneau Cover to prevent panel separation and apply warning labels, free of charge. In addition, an updated accessory user’s information manual will be provided. The recall began October 26, 2020. Owners may contact HondaeBay logo customer service at 1-888-234-2138. HondaeBay logo’s number for this recall is F8M.

BACKGROUND

If the HondaeBay logo Genuine accessory tonneau cover is not properly attached and secured, or the vehicle is driven with it partially open, a section of the cover may detach from the vehicle, causing a possible road hazard and increasing the risk of a crash or injury.

REPAIR PROCEDURE

  1. Open the tailgate.
  2. Pull down the tonneau cover handle to release the hook from the rear bracket, then slide it inward while pulling down. Store the handle in the cross member. Do this step on the other side.
tonneau cover handle

 

  1. Fold the tonneau cover up toward the cabin (open position).
Fold the tonneau cover

 

  1. While the cover is in the open position, remove the D-rings and tethers straps from the center panel and throw them away. Retain the tapping screws.
tapping screws

 

  1. Using two of the tapping screws you just removed, install the template from the kit to where you removed the D-ring.
template

 

  1. Unfold the tonneau cover so the rear panel is sitting above the center panel. Take the other end of the template, and line it up with the edge of the hinge as shown. Then secure the template with masking tape.
template

template

 

  1. Use a center punch tool to mark the hinge holes as shown on the template.
Use a center punch tool to mark the hinge holes

 

  1. Carefully remove the two screws and masking tape holding the template in place. Discard the two screws and masking tape, but keep the template. You will need it again.
  2. Repeat steps 5 thru 7 on the other side of the panel using the same template and the remaining two tapping screws.
  3. Use a 2.5 mm drill bit to drill holes on the four punch marks, then remove any burrs.

 

NOTICE

Use masking tape to serve as a drill stop at 5 mm. If you drill too deep you can damage the hinge.

Use masking tape to serve as a drill stop

 

  1. Install the new D-ring with the tether strap end to the rear panel using new tapping screws. Start the screws by hand, then torque them with the 1/4 inch drive torque wrench to 25 Nยทm (20 lb-in). Repeat this step on the other side (driver/passenger side).
new D-ring

 

  1. Install the other new D-ring to the center panel using new tapping screws. Start the screws by hand, then torque them with the 1/4 inch drive torque wrench to 25 Nยทm (20 lb-in). Repeat this step on the other side (driver/passenger side).
D-ring

 

  1. Use isopropyl alcohol to thoroughly clean the surface of the rear panel where you will install the warning label. Make sure the alcohol is completely dry, then install the label as shown, and apply pressure to the entire surface of the label using a trim roller.

 

NOTE

Make sure the warning labelโ€™s orientation is correct. The orange should be facing toward the front of the vehicle.

D-ring

 

  1. Fold the tonneau cover to the open position, and use isopropyl alcohol to thoroughly clean the surface of the center panel where you will install the warning label. Make sure the alcohol is completely dry, then install the label as shown and apply pressure to the entire surface of the label using a trim roller.
install the warning label

 

  1. With the tonneau cover in the open position, latch the buckles on the new tether strap and tonneau cover on one side. Then, pull on the tether to make sure the buckle stays latched. Repeat this step on the other side. Once you make sure the buckles are secure, unlatch the buckles, and secure the snap on the tether to the tonneau cover.

 

tether strap

 

  1. Unfold the tonneau cover to the closed position. Pull down the tonneau cover handle on one side, slide it toward the bed lining while pulling down, then attach the hook to the rear bracket. Repeat this step on the other side.

 

tonneau cover

 

  1. Close the tailgate.
  2. Have the service advisor give the new accessory userโ€™s information manual from the kit to the customer.

TORRANCE, Calif. โ€“ Sept. 24, 2020 โ€“ American HondaeBay logo will voluntarily recall 28,885

HondaeBay logo Genuine Accessory tonneau covers that may have been installed on 2017-2020 HondaeBay logo Ridgeline pickup trucks in the United States. No related crashes or injuries have been reported.

 

The HondaeBay logo Genuine Accessory tonneau cover for the 2017โ€“2020 HondaeBay logo Ridgeline is a tri-fold design that can be positioned to either partially cover (open) or completely cover (closed) the truck bed. If the tonneau cover is not properly secured in the open or closed position and the vehicle is operated at highway speeds, the wind resistance may cause the tonneau cover to flip and buckle, deforming the hinges between the center and rear panel. Deformed hinges could allow the rear panel to separate from the tonneau cover, creating a road hazard and increasing the risk of a crash or injury.

 

To complete the free recall repair, an authorized HondaeBay logo dealer will install a tether between the tonneau coverโ€™s center and rear panel to prevent panel separation, and apply warning labels to the tonneau cover. In addition, the dealer will provide an updated accessory userโ€™s information manual, which instructs the owner to properly secure the tonneau cover prior to vehicle operation.

Chronology:

 

June 2017

HondaeBay logo Canada received the first claim of a panel separating from the tonneau cover. HondaeBay logo Canada reviewed the claim, found that customer misuse contributed to the failure, and decided to monitor the market for similar activity.

 

July 2017

HondaeBay logo received another claim of a panel separating from the tonneau cover, which marked the first claim from the U.S. market. HondaeBay logo reviewed the claim and performed re-creation testing, which found that the customer forcibly closed the tonneau cover on top of objects protruding from the top of the truck bed. Forcing the tonneau cover closed bent the hinges, resulting in panel separation (customer misuse). HondaeBay logo decided to monitor the market for similar activity.

 

October to November, 2019

HondaeBay logo launched an investigation into the tonneau cover panel separation issue based on increased market activity, which included interviewing customers who claimed to have experienced a failure.

 

December 2019

Information from the customer interviews guided HondaeBay logo in re-creation testing, which identified a potential scenario for rear panel separation when the tonneau cover was not properly secured and the vehicle was operating at highway speeds. Panel separation was limited to hinge deformations on the rear panel, as the hinge design between the front and center panel was not susceptible to deformation caused by an improperly secured tonneau cover. HondaeBay logo performed quality inspections at the tonneau coverโ€™s Tier-1 supplier, which did not identify any irregularities in workmanship or processes.

 

February 2020

A survey of customers who claimed to have experienced a failure supported the failure mode identified during the earlier interview process.

 

March 2020

HondaeBay logo performed quality inspections at the tonneau coverโ€™s Tier-2 supplier, which did not identify any irregularities in workmanship or processes.

 

April to August, 2020

HondaeBay logo reviewed comparable products in the market and the associated instructions for proper usage. Based on this review, HondaeBay logo investigated whether modifications to the design or usage instructions were appropriate.

 

September 10, 2020

HondaeBay logo determined that a defect related to motor vehicle safety existed and decided to conduct a safety recall.

 

As of September 10, 2020, HondaeBay logo has received 17 warranty claims, three field reports, and no reports of injuries or crashes related to this issue.

Defect description:

The HondaeBay logo Genuine Accessory tonneau cover for 2017โ€“2020 MY HondaeBay logo Ridgeline is a tri-fold design that can be positioned to either partially cover (open) or completely cover (closed) the truck bed. If the tonneau cover is not properly secured in the open or closed position, and the vehicle is operated at highway speeds, the wind resistance may cause the tonneau cover to flip and buckle, deforming the hinges between the center and rear panel. Deformed hinges could allow the rear panel to separate from the tonneau cover, creating a road hazard and increasing the risk of a crash or injury.

Program for remedying the defect:

Registered owners of all 2017โ€“2020 MY HondaeBay logo Ridgelines will be contacted by mail and asked to take their vehicle to an authorized HondaeBay logo dealer. The dealer will inspect the vehicle for the HondaeBay logo Genuine Accessory tonneau cover and if equipped, will install a tether between the tonneau coverโ€™s center and rear panel to prevent panel separation, and apply warning labels to the tonneau cover. In addition, the dealer will provide an updated accessory userโ€™s information manual which instructs the owner to properly secure the tonneau cover prior to vehicle operation.

Owners who have paid to have these repairs completed at their own expense will be eligible for reimbursement, according to the recall reimbursement plan on file with NHTSA.
